Hi,
I've successfully installed KnoppMyth as a frontend system on my loungeroom PC. It connects to my KnoppMyth server and gets all of the media and settings from the server without a problem. The hassle I've got is that when playing either Live TV or Recorded TV it fills the 4:3 screen even though it's 16:9 DVB-T Broadcast. When I go to the menu and change the Aspect Ratio to something else or press (W) it doesn't change the Aspect Ratio at all. It does work fine on the server where everything is stored just not on the new front end.

lspci | grep VGA reports this:
00:02.0 VGA compatible controller: Intel Corporation 82915G/GV/910GL Integrated Graphics Controller (rev 04)

I can't see anything that I might have missed! Any ideas?

Stupid Question time! :) Which is the default config file for X that stores the graphics card info? I used to always go to /etc/X11/XF86config but it isn't there. Is it all under /etc/X11/xorg.conf? If so I think I've found the problem seeing that this file appears to only point to the vesa driver and not the i810.

Let me know if I'm close!

Thanks! I'll be sure to read them next time before I start configuring.

I've got it working now anyway. I changed the vesa driver over to the i810 driver and it's working perfectly and with a better frame rate as well.
